What “La Cala Village” really means

When buyers refer to La Cala Village, they are usually talking about: 

  • Walking access to shops, restaurants and daily services 
  • Easy reach of the beach and paseo without needing a car 
  • Flatter terrain than surrounding areas 
  • A lived-in, year-round atmosphere rather than resort living 

 

This is not about being in the middle of nightlife or activity — it’s about being close enough that daily life feels effortless. 

Who buys in La Cala Village?

Buyers in La Cala Village are typically lifestyle-led, informed and pragmatic. 

Common buyer profiles include: 

  • Downsizers seeking simplicity and walkability 
  • Second-home owners wanting lock-up-and-leave ease 
  • Full-time expats prioritising routine over novelty 
  • Buyers planning long stays or permanent relocation 

 

Key pattern: Buyers here will accept smaller homes, modest terraces and older interiors — but they won’t compromise on location. 

This is why well-located properties often outperform larger, newer homes outside the village.

What sells well in the village (and why)

Demand in La Cala Village follows very clear patterns. 

Strong performers: 

  • Genuine walking distance to the village and beach 
  • Lift access (where available) 
  • Usable outdoor space, even when compact 
  • Good natural light and practical layouts 
  • Clear modernisation potential 

 

Rare but highly valued when present: 

  • Private or allocated parking 
  • Storage rooms 

 

Less important than sellers expect: 

  • Large interior square metres 
  • Oversized terraces (which are uncommon in the village) 
  • High-spec finishes that don’t improve day-to-day living

Local reality: Most village properties require some level of modernisation. Buyers expect this and factor it into both price and decision-making.

La Cala Village behaves differently to newer developments and out-of-centre locations. 

  • Prices are more resistant to discounting due to limited supply 
  • Condition plays a major role in buyer perception 
  • Buyers quickly adjust for kitchens, bathrooms and electrics 
  • Over-priced “needs modernisation” properties lose momentum fast 
  • Realistically priced homes with renovation potential attract steady interest 

Reality check: Modernisation isn’t a problem in this market — unrealistic pricing is. 

Buyers here are decisive, but only when price and condition align honestly.

Living in La Cala Village day to day

This is one of the few places on the Costa del Sol where daily life doesn’t require planning. 

  • Morning walks along the paseo 
  • Coffee, errands and dinners without relying on a car 
  • A compact, walkable centre that works year-round 
  • A strong local community rather than seasonal churn 

 

Flat streets and scale make La Cala Village particularly attractive to buyers thinking about long-term ease and future practicality.

Selling in La Cala Village: what really matters

If you’re selling in La Cala Village, buyers already understand the compromises that come with village living. What they’re assessing is whether the price reflects reality. 

 You add value by: 

  • Pricing realistically from day one 
  • Being honest about condition and required updates 
  • Presenting the property cleanly and clearly 
  • Highlighting walkability accurately, not optimistically 

 

You risk losing value by: 

  • Pricing as if modernisation isn’t needed 
  • Overselling terrace size or features that aren’t typical 
  • Comparing your home to renovated properties outside the village 

Seller insight: Buyers don’t mind doing work — they mind paying for work twice.

Property types in La Cala Village

La Cala Village is characterised by: 

  • Older low-rise apartment buildings 
  • A small number of townhouses 
  • Very limited new development 
  • Tightly held resale stock 

 

Scarcity and walkability are the primary drivers of long-term demand here.
